DATA POINTS: What we learned from Friday practice in Spain

Formula 1 teams were greeted by bright and toasty conditions in the familiar surroundings of Spain’s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ya on Friday. The layout is renowned as the ideal testbed for every aspect of car design, courtesy of its variety of corners.
This year, that design has featured a tweak with the removal of the final chicane to leave a super-fast double right to end the lap – much to the delight of the drivers.
